This Classic Homemade Caesar Dressing is bold, creamy, and packed with flavor from fresh garlic, anchovy paste, and lemon juice. Perfect for drizzling over salads, wraps, or using as a dip, it comes together in just minutes and stores beautifully in the fridge.
Ingredients
1 cup mayonnaise
1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
1 tablespoon anchovy paste
2 cloves garlic, minced
2 tablespoons lemon juice
1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
1/2 cup Parmesan cheese, freshly grated
1/4 cup olive oil
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on black pepper
Instructions
1. In a blender or bowl, combine mayonnaise, Dijon mustard, anchovy paste, garlic, and lemon juice. Blend or whisk until fully combined.
2. Slowly drizzle in olive oil while continuously blending or whisking to create a smooth emulsion.
3. Stir in Parmesan cheese, Worcestershire sauce, salt, and black pepper. Adjust seasoning to taste.
4. Transfer to a jar or container and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es before serving.
Notes
For a traditional touch, substitute mayonnaise with 1 egg yolk and emulsify carefully.
Let the dressing rest in the fridge before serving to allow flavors to blend.
Always use freshly grated Parmesan for the best flavor and consistency.
